What Stands Out
Product Details
- Max Working pressure: 3MPa, Security pressure: 2MPa
- Working temperature: 280℃ / 536℉, Security temperature:260℃ / 500℉
- Heating / Cooling rate: 5°C/min,41℉/min
- PPL liner has high lubricity, non-stickiness, high temperature resistance, and more
- 304 stainless steel body with thickened wall for high-pressure air-tight reaction environment
- Hydrothermal Autoclave reactor for high pressure, high temperature hydrothermal reactions

Customer Questions & Answers
-
Question:
What is a Hydrothermal Synthesis Autoclave Reactor used for?
Answer: A Hydrothermal Synthesis Autoclave Reactor is used for conducting hydrothermal synthesis reactions under controlled temperature and pressure conditions. This enables the synthesis of advanced materials, such as nanoparticles and ceramics, often employed in research and industrial applications. Its design supports high-grade chemical reactions, which are crucial for producing materials with specific properties for electronics, catalysts, and pharmaceuticals. -
Question:
What are the features of the PPL lined vessel in the reactor?
Answer: The PPL lined vessel provides superior chemical resistance, ensuring durability during highly reactive or corrosive reactions. PPL, or Polypropylene Lined, is designed to withstand high temperatures and pressures, which are typical in hydrothermal synthesis processes. This feature is critical for achieving the desired material properties and ensuring the longevity of the reactor in experimental settings. -
Question:
Can I use this reactor for synthesizing metals?
Answer: Yes, the Hydrothermal Synthesis Autoclave Reactor is suitable for synthesizing various metal oxides and other metal compounds. The controlled environment allows precise manipulation of reaction conditions, essential for producing high-purity metal products. Researchers in materials science, especially those focusing on nanomaterials, often utilize this reactor for developing specific metallic compounds vital for electronics and catalysts. -

Features & Benefits
- Hydrothermal Synthesis Autoclave is a closed container used for hydrothermal reactions.
- It dissolves refractory material using a strong acid/alkali, high temperature, and pressure-confined environment.
- It can be used for sample dissolution pre-treatment in analysis like atomic absorption spectroscopy and plasma emission.
- It is made of 304 stainless steel reactor and has a PPL lining.
- It can easily dissolve samples, and its PPL liner has no dead angles, high lubricity, and almost insoluble in all solvents.
- The kettle lid and body have a durable and reliable cable sealing structure.
